#df0478 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#df0478 is composed of 87.5% red, 1.6%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.2% magenta, 46.2%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 328.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 44.5%. #df0478 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08f0 with #bf0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#df0478

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0006 is the darkest color, while #fff7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#df0478

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#766d72 is the less saturated color, while #df0478 is the most saturated one.
